Leather is a natural material derived from animal hides, primarily cows, and its durability is attributed to the collagen fibers within the hide, which provide strength and flexibility.

The process of tanning transforms raw animal hides into leather, making it resistant to decay.

This chemical process often involves tannins, which can be derived from tree bark, or synthetic chemicals, influencing the leather's texture and longevity.

Vegetable-tanned leather, often considered more eco-friendly, uses natural tannins from plants.

This method can take several months and results in a more durable product that ages beautifully over time.

Full-grain leather, the highest quality available, retains the natural grain and imperfections of the hide, which not only enhances its aesthetic appeal but also contributes to its durability.

Leather can absorb moisture, which can lead to mold and bacteria growth if not properly cared for.

Regular conditioning helps maintain its suppleness and prevents drying out, which can cause cracking.

The average lifespan of a well-cared-for leather briefcase can exceed 20 years, significantly outlasting synthetic materials, which often degrade and lose their aesthetic appeal much sooner.

A quality leather briefcase may include metal hardware made from brass or stainless steel, which not only provides a robust closure mechanism but can also resist rust and corrosion better than cheaper alternatives.

The color of leather can significantly affect its usability; darker shades tend to hide scratches and stains better, while lighter colors may require more maintenance to keep them looking pristine.

The craftsmanship behind high-quality leather briefcases often involves artisanal techniques, where skilled artisans hand-stitch and assemble the bags, ensuring attention to detail and longevity.

The price point of leather briefcases can vary widely, influenced by factors such as the quality of leather, brand reputation, and design complexity, with some luxury brands commanding prices that reflect their heritage and craftsmanship.

The concept of "patina" refers to the natural aging process of leather, where it develops a unique character over time, often appreciated by owners as a sign of authenticity and personal history.

Understanding the differences in leather grades—such as top-grain, corrected-grain, and genuine leather—can help consumers make informed decisions, as these variations affect both the appearance and durability of the briefcase.
